how many Mg atoms are presented in 3.00 moles of MgCl2

Answer:

1.81 x 10²⁴ atoms

Explanation:

To find the number of atoms in the given number of moles, we need to understand that every substance contains the Avogadro's number of particles.

More appropriately, a mole of any substance will contain the Avogadro's number of particles which is 6.02 x 10²³ atoms

 So;

           If 1 mole of a substance  = 6.02 x 10²³ atoms;

               3 mole of MgCl₂ will contain 3 x 6.02 x 10²³ = 1.81 x 10²⁴ atoms
